**Be visionary** Teledyne Technologies Incorporated provides enabling technologies for industrial growth markets that require advanced technology and high reliability. These markets include aerospace and defense, factory automation, air and water quality environmental monitoring, electronics design and development, oceanographic research, deepwater oil and gas exploration and production, medical imaging and pharmaceutical research. We are looking for individuals who thrive on making an impact and want the excitement of being on a team that wins. **Job Description** Teledyne Micropac is looking for a Power Test Engineer to take the lead role in creating test solutions for our expanding power conversion product line. This position requires a power electronics background focused on creating both software and hardware for automated characterization and production test development. **What you 'll do: ** Essential functions of the job will include but not limited to: * Develop automated characterization and production test solutions, including both test fixture hardware and software, for AC-DC, DC-DC converters, power inverters, and multi-rail VPX power supply cards, etc. * Generating test reports from data collected and ability to present the data in concise formats (statistical analysis, 2D/3D graphs, histograms, specification compliance matrix, etc.). * Excellent understanding of how to perform key power conversion measurements such as efficiency, load and line regulation (both transient and DC), gain-phase analysis, power sequencing/timing, etc. * Creating automated solutions for use during EMI/EMC testing at off-site test chambers. * Developing automated test solutions for TVAC testing. * Reviewing product specifications and/or design specifications for test solution development requirements and test hardware needs. **What you need** * Bachelor’s degree in Electrical Engineering, Electronics Engineering, Semiconductor Engineering with 5 years of relevant experience
